Transaction 58fc9c1cf425fc85d44da5b6b021b844acc969fca704c53f8ea653b198b05977
1 Input
1 Output
-
58fc9c1cf425fc85d44da5b6b021b844acc969fca704c53f8ea653b198b05977:0
- value
- 2036859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20ee47bda3ea9bc6bb7a88a2acd188fd6e236682 OP_EQUAL
- address
- 34h8zgbStTE5nUtEnPXt4rdQsA1RT8yRMs